البراشن
Root entry · 2 derived lemmasThis root appears to relate to the act of extending one's gaze or sight. It also includes place names and tribal designations.
Derived headwords
البَرَاشِنnoun
- 1.one who extends gazeclassical
Refers to someone who extends their sight and looks intently.
بُرْشَانname
- 1.place nameclassical
A place name.
- 2.tribe nameclassical
A tribal designation.
Parallel reading
البراشن، بالضم: الذي يمد نظره ويحده.
Al-Barāshin (with dammah): he who extends his gaze and focuses it.
وبرشان: د أو قبيلة.
And Burshān: a place or a tribe.
